Detailed explanation-1: -The digestive enzymes of lysosomes breakdown unwanted (waste) substances and worn out cell parts. Hence, they can be considered as the waste disposal system of the cell.

Detailed explanation-2: -Cells also have to recycle compartments called organelles when they become old and worn out. For this task, they rely on an organelle called the lysosome, which works like a cellular stomach.

Detailed explanation-3: -Lysosomes and peroxisomes. These organelles are the recycling center of the cell. They digest foreign bacteria that invade the cell, rid the cell of toxic substances, and recycle worn-out cell components.

Detailed explanation-4: -Lysosomes are membrane-enclosed organelles that contain an array of enzymes capable of breaking down all types of biological polymers-proteins, nucleic acids, carbohydrates, and lipids.
